About Us :

Established in 1969, Austin ENT Clinic is one of the leading Ear, Nose and Throat clinics in the nation. Our physicians specialize in otolaryngologic care for pediatric and adult patients at locations across the greater Austin area.

Our practice features state-of-the-art care for ear, nose, and throat problems, hearing loss, environmental allergies, sinus, and head and neck surgery.

We offer a variety of highly specialized procedures that utilize the latest medical technology.

What you will be doing :

You will be responsible for providing strong leadership and supervision of our growing ENT, audiology, and allergy business, consisting of 8 locations.

You will oversee the daily operations, continuously monitor and direct processes, train and develop staff, manage individual and team performance, work with stakeholders to drive positive change, and develop an exceptional work culture.

What you will need : Experience :

Experience :

  • At least 9 years of recent direct experience as a physician practice manager or clinical manager for a specialty physician group practice (or extremely similar) required
  • At least 5+ years of direct experience leading a multi-site physician practice for a specialty physician group (or extremely similar) required
  • At least 3+ years of multi-site management with direct oversight of the clinic manager or practice manager
  • NOTE : dental, vision, physical therapy, mental health, and chiropractic experience will not be considered towards the requirements for this position
  • At least 7 years of experience using an EMR required
  • At least 7 years of people management of 25+ employees
  • At least 7 years of P&L experience required
  • Authority to hire / fire experience required

Skills :

  • Strong leadership and management skills
  • Strong leader with player / coach mentality
  • Strong time management, multi-tasking, task prioritization, and organizational skills
  • Strong critical thinking, investigational, and problem-solving skills
  • Strong understanding of physician practice regulations and certifications
  • Strong understanding of physician practice clinical workflow best practices
  • Knowledge and understanding of third-party payers, HMOs, PPOs, Medicare, Medicaid, etc.
  • Knowledge and understanding of insurance benefits (deductibles, copays, coinsurance) and eligibility verification
  • Knowledge and understanding of prior authorization / precertification
  • Knowledge and understanding of HIPAA, OSHA, and other applicable regulations
  • Ability to analyze and interpret financial data / reports
  • Ability to operate in a dynamic, rapidly changing environment, adapting to the needs of the organization and employees

Education :

  • Bachelor's degree in health or business administration required
  • Related billing or coding certifications preferred
